Parent Voice

Partnership with Parents is key to the success of our school and vital in ensuring our students can achieve their potential.

Parent Voice is held termly from 6-7pm in the school's Learning Resource Centre. It is a chance for parents and/or carers to speak to a senior member of staff about any issues arising and become more involved in the life of the school. There is a focus for each meeting which is shared in advance and this is emailed to families nearer the time of the meeting. These events are brilliant opportunities to discuss all attributes of STAGS life with parents and carers.
